    I was diagnosed in 2014. After surgery but before chemo we went to Paris for 4 days. A specialist insurance company charged  £40  which wasn't too bad. Exactly a year later after chemo and RT the same company for same 4 day trip to Paris wanted £400 abd this was just for me.  Needless to say I looked elsewhere.  We are going to new Zealand and Australia in January/February and the insurance has cost £320 for both of us 

  • If you’re going to Europe only, try Eurotunnel, they like to quote over the phone as if you do it on line they think it’s for the tunnel. Only provisos are you are travelling with approval of your doctor and are not terminal.

    Further away I would recommend www.insurancewith.com as they are not only competitive, but settle claims easily and swiftly too. Daughter has an annual policy with them now, (she travels widely for work as well as pleasure) found them really good. Again they like you to phone.
